Rust Implementation Patterns

Use this skill for idiomatic Rust with a practical bias toward Tauri-backed desktop application logic. Assume the Rust side often owns heavy operations such as filesystem work, process orchestration, indexing, background tasks, editor services, and stable IPC with the frontend.

Delivery Workflow

Use the checklist below and track progress:

Rust progress:
- [ ] Step 1: Discover crate boundaries, module layout, and Tauri integration points
- [ ] Step 2: Model ownership, data flow, and error shapes explicitly
- [ ] Step 3: Implement logic with small focused types and functions
- [ ] Step 4: Handle async work, IO, and concurrency without blocking UI flows
- [ ] Step 5: Verify tests, formatting, linting, and boundary behavior

Core Rust Rules

  • Model ownership intentionally before writing broad mutable flows.
  • Prefer simple types and explicit lifetimes over clever abstractions.
  • Use the type system to make invalid states difficult to represent.
  • Keep functions small, intention-revealing, and focused on one capability.
  • Avoid writing TypeScript, C++, or Java in Rust syntax.

Data Modeling and Errors

  • Prefer structs and enums that encode real domain meaning.
  • Use Result and Option intentionally; do not erase failure modes behind generic strings.
  • Model recoverable application errors explicitly and keep infrastructure errors distinguishable.
  • Use thiserror or the project-standard error pattern when structured errors improve clarity.
  • Keep serialization DTOs separate from internal domain types when the boundary is non-trivial.

Async, IO, and Concurrency

  • Keep blocking filesystem, process, or indexing work off the main async path when it can stall responsiveness.
  • Use the project's async runtime conventions consistently.
  • Preserve cancellation and shutdown behavior where long-running tasks exist.
  • Prefer message passing, task isolation, or scoped ownership over broad shared mutable state.
  • Make background work observable and controllable when it affects the UI experience.
